UPDATED: Officer involved shooting in Alpena County
ALPENA — On Thursday, at approximately 8:40 a.m., deputies from the Presque Isle County Sheriff’s Department attempted a traffic stop on a pickup truck near Rogers City. The vehicle was driven by a 33-year-old male who was known to deputies to be a wanted felon.
The suspect fled the scene, and a vehicle pursuit was initiated. The pursuit continued into Alpena County and concluded when the suspect’s vehicle crashed into a ditch on M-65 near Leer Road in Long Rapids Township.
Upon exiting the vehicle, the suspect was observed holding a firearm. Deputies discharged their department issued weapons, striking the suspect. Deputies immediately rendered medical aid on scene. The suspect was transported to the hospital and is currently listed in stable condition. No deputies were injured during the incident.
The Michigan State Police (MSP) Investigative Response Team and MSP Crime Lab responded to investigate and process the scene.
The investigation remains ongoing. Additional information will be provided when it becomes available
